Applications and Tested Dilutions
| Application | Tested Dilution |
|---|---|
| Western Blot (WB) | 1:5,000–1:10,000 |
| Immunohistochemistry (Paraffin) (IHC (P)) | 1:20 |
| Immunocytochemistry (ICC/IF) | 1:200 |
| Flow Cytometry (Flow) | 1:50–1:100 |
Product Specifications
| 항목 | 내용 |
|---|---|
| Species Reactivity | Human, Mouse, Rat, Zebrafish |
| Host / Isotype | Mouse / IgG1 |
| Class | Monoclonal |
| Type | Antibody |
| Clone | 1-B11 |
| Immunogen | Synthetic peptide within human Beta tubulin aa 51–100 |
| Conjugate | Unconjugated |
| Form | Liquid |
| Concentration | 2 mg/mL |
| Purification | Protein A |
| Storage Buffer | PBS, pH 7.4, with 0.2% BSA, 40% glycerol |
| Contains | 0.05% sodium azide |
| Storage Conditions | Store at 4°C short term. For long term storage, store at -20°C, avoiding freeze/thaw cycles. |
| Shipping Conditions | Ambient (domestic); Wet ice (international) |
| RRID | AB_2931531 |

Target Information
Beta tubulins are one of two core protein families (alpha and beta tubulins) that heterodimerize and assemble to form microtubules. Beta-III tubulin is primarily expressed in neurons and may be involved in neurogenesis, axon guidance, and maintenance. Mutations in the beta tubulin gene are associated with congenital fibrosis of the extraocular muscles type 3. Beta-III tubulin is also detected in Sertoli cells of the testis and transiently in non-neuronal embryonic tissues. Glutamate residues at the C-terminus of beta III tubulin can be glutamylated, though the functional significance remains unclear.
Tubulin is phosphorylated on Ser-172 by CDK1 during cell cycle progression, and this phosphorylation inhibits its incorporation into microtubules. Microtubules, composed of alpha and beta tubulin dimers (~55 kDa each), play essential roles in chromosome segregation, intracellular transport, ciliary and flagellar movement, and cytoskeletal structure. Because beta-tubulin is ubiquitously expressed in all eukaryotic cells, it is frequently used as a loading control in protein detection assays such as Western blotting.
